full-mann 10 Geschrieben 12. November 2010 Melden Geschrieben 12. November 2010 Hai, kann man bei einer MSSQL-Datenbank sehen, wann die das letzte mal genutzt wurde? Egal, ob lesend oder schreibend? Habe danach gegooglet aber nichts gefunden. Hat jemand von euch eine Idee? Vielen Dank schon mal im Voraus.
NilsK 3.051 Geschrieben 12. November 2010 Melden Geschrieben 12. November 2010 Moin, was willst du denn rausfinden? Gruß, Nils
full-mann 10 Geschrieben 12. November 2010 Autor Melden Geschrieben 12. November 2010 Wir haben einen Server, bei dem die Arbeitsspeicher-Auslastung ziemlich hoch ist. Den meisten Speicher zieht sich der MSSQL-Server. Im SQL-Server haben wir einige Datenbanken, von denen mir keiner meine Kollegen sagen kann, ob die noch benötigt werden. Ich gehe davon aus, dass ziemlich viele Altlasten vorhanden sind. Ich möchte aber nicht einfach die Datenbanken offline nehmen und schauen was passiert. Interessant wäre es daher zu sehen, welche Datenbank von irgendwelchen Programmen genutzt wird oder nicht.
NilsK 3.051 Geschrieben 12. November 2010 Melden Geschrieben 12. November 2010 Moin, das bedeutet, du hast neben SQL Server noch weitere Applikationen auf dem Server? Das ist generell keine gute Idee. Dass SQL Server sich so viel Speicher nimmt, wie er bekommen kann, ist normal, denn genau das soll ein Datenbankserver i.d.R. auch tun. Wenn er ihn nicht benötigt, gibt er ihn auch wieder frei. Eine Datenbank, die nicht genutzt wird, belegt auch praktisch keinen Speicher, denn SQL Server hält nur die Daten im Speicher, die er auch verarbeitet. Die aktuellen Verbindungen zum Server kannst du dir im SSMS anzeigen, dort steht auch, welche Datenbank offen ist. Diese Information bekommst du auch per SQL-Abfrage über das Kommando sp_who. Sonst hast du natürlich auch Loggiong-Möglichkeiten, aber in deinem Szenario dürfte das zu weit führen - zudem ist es juristisch heikel. Gruß, Nils
full-mann 10 Geschrieben 12. November 2010 Autor Melden Geschrieben 12. November 2010 Hai, sp_who war genau das was ich gesucht habe. Vielen Dank!!!
NilsK 3.051 Geschrieben 12. November 2010 Melden Geschrieben 12. November 2010 Moin, prima, vielen Dank für die Rückmeldung! Gruß, Nils
Empfohlene Beiträge
Erstelle ein Benutzerkonto oder melde dich an, um zu kommentieren
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können
Benutzerkonto erstellen
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!
Neues Benutzerkonto erstellenAnmelden
Du hast bereits ein Benutzerkonto? Melde dich hier an.
Jetzt anmelden